Full Job Description

In this role, youll make an impact in the following ways:

  • Follow and add to our defined architecture, technology standards, and best practices for applications, middleware, and databases for development
  • Work with the team and architect on design, prototyping and delivery of software solutions, helping manage the technical environment (software, data, interfaces, integration), researching new tools and technologies, and help with developing better analytics solutions.
  • Foster a culture of learning, innovating, and continuous improvement
  • Promote engineering best practices to deliver software via rapid iterations and frequent releases
  • Actively participate in daily stand-up meetings and other Agile ceremonies
  • Collaborate with other engineering teams to ensure timely delivery across all the systems at the program level
  • Troubleshoot and resolve production issues promptly to minimize impact.



To be successful in this role, were seeking the following:

  • Bachelors degree in computer science or related discipline preferred
  • 5+ years of mainframe experience
  • Demonstrated skill in AI prompting and the practical use of AI tools to improve development productivity, problem-solving, and support workflows

  • COBOL (CICS), JCL, CICS, VSAM

  • MQ

  • DB2, SQL

  • Micro-Services Architecture, Scalable High Resiliency Systems, Workflow is preferred.

  • Experience in Agile methodologies, either Sprint or Kanban

  • Solid grasp of Git, CI/CD, Agile principles

  • Strong technical and communication skills required

  • Knowledge and experience in financial services or fintech is preferred
